Private Maths and Physics Tutor in Swindon

I have a Batchelors degree in Mechanical Engineering & over 20 years of experience in the electronics industry.
I have a good working knowledge of the subject & I am passionate about helping the next generation meet their goals.

Tutoring Experience

I am new to Tutoring as a role, but I have been able to support family members & colleagues to improve their skills & achieve their grades.

Tutoring Approach

I am flexible in my approach to new students, I am happy to adapt and plan according to individual requirements.
During the first session, I will identify the current ability of the student, along with their desire to improve and their aptitude to learn.
I find working 1-to-1 with students in a quiet environment with minimal distractions yields the best results. It helps build confidence in the student & facilitates their development.
I like to use conversation, discussion & examples to encourage the student to learn & develop the skills necessary to excel at maths.
After all, Maths is essentially a series of building blocks (or skills) used to solve a problem. The key is to identify which blocks to use in which order to provide the best solution.
